DIPLOMA IN SOCIAL WORK AND CO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T
MODULE 1 (KNEC)
SOCIAL WORK THEORY, PRACTICE AND CO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T
(OCT/NOV 2012)

SECTION A: SOCIAL WORK THEORY

1. a) The function of social work and the role played by the social worker in our society has been influenced by major social changes that have occurred over the past two decades. Discuss five of these social changes in contemporary society. (10 marks)
b) Indentify five difficulties of leadership and management issues associated with joint working when social workers are operating in teams with other professionals (10 marks)

2. a) List ten fields of professional social work practice directly related to academic levels (10 marks)
b) The code of ethics is relevant to all social workers and social work students, regardless of their professional function, the settings in which they works, or the populations they serve. Explain six purposes of the code of ethics (10 marks)

3. a) i. Explain social learning theory (2 marks)
ii. Evaluate the cognitive factors in social learning theory (10 marks)
b) List and explain four types of groups in social work (8 marks)

4. a) Explain five basic elements of effective group work (10 marks)
b) Discuss five areas that humanistic existential theory can be used in social work (10 marks)

SECTION B: CO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T

5. a) Describe five main approaches in community work in the early 1980s (10 marks)
b) Highlight five assumptions underlying community development (10 marks)

6. a) State ten factors considered in community programme entry when initiating a new project
(10 marks)
b) Explain five functions of the District Development Community (DDC) in planning and implementing development services (10 marks)

7. a) Highlight five problems that change agents experience is community services (10 marks)
b) Evaluate in steps the factors which influence social action model (10 marks)

8. a) i. Explain the term community organization (2 marks)
ii. Highlight the “lif-cycle” of four periods of community organization (8 marks)
b) Discuss five problems encountered in community development in Kenya (10 marks)
